Garamendi with the 2022 Service Academy Nominees for California’s 3rd Congressional District
Suisun City, CA—Congressman John Garamendi (D-CA) hosted a reception at VFW Post 2333 in Suisun City to honor 10 students from the 3rd Congressional District whom he nominated and have been accepted into one of the nation’s military service academies.
The young men and women competing for nominations this year include an outstanding group of individuals. While all applicants demonstrated the dedication, courage, and aptitude necessary to excel at an academy, only a select few of the most qualified individuals are able to receive a nomination each year. Nominations are based on the applicant’s academic strength, extracurricular activities, and an extensive interview process.
“Each year I have the privilege of nominating a select group of young men and women to America’s service academies,” said Garamendi. “Our nation’s military service academies have a long-standing tradition of excellence in education, service, and integrity, and I am proud to have such remarkable nominees represent the 3rd Congressional District. I salute our nominees and thank them for their commitment to our country.”
